Protective Order Petitions
Protective orders, sometimes called restraining orders, are used to restrict contact between individuals when violence or threats have occurred. These orders can be temporary or long-term and often involve court hearings to determine if legal protection is necessary.
Defense Against Abuse Allegations
In some cases, a person may be falsely accused of domestic violence, especially during a contentious breakup or custody dispute. Legal defense in these cases involves presenting clear evidence, witness statements, and cross-examination of claims to protect the accused’s legal rights.
Emergency Custody Related To Abuse
When domestic violence involves children, emergency custody may be granted to protect their safety. These situations require swift court action and may also affect future parenting arrangements.
Child Custody And Visitation Restrictions
Domestic violence allegations can impact decisions related to parenting time and custody. Courts will weigh any history of abuse when deciding whether supervised visits, restrictions, or modifications are appropriate.
Separation And Divorce Tied To Domestic Abuse
Abuse within a relationship frequently results in separation or divorce and may influence decisions about property division, financial support, and child custody. Legal representation helps clarify how the abuse influences other parts of the case and supports the survivor’s legal position.
Post-order Enforcement And Violations
Our Greensboro domestic violence lawyer shares that if a protective order is violated, the court may impose penalties or take further protective actions. These cases involve documenting the violation and appearing before the court to request additional enforcement or consequences.
Modifications To Protective Orders
Either party may request changes to a protective order if circumstances have changed or if the order is no longer necessary. Courts evaluate evidence carefully before agreeing to lift or revise an order that affects contact or movement.
Domestic Violence Involving Elder Abuse
In some cases, domestic violence takes the form of elder abuse within families or caregiving relationships. These cases require both protective legal action and coordination with social services to safeguard the individual’s well-being.
